The Essential Role of the Water Pump in a 2009 Holden Captiva 7
The 2009 Holden Captiva 7 is a versatile and dependable SUV that has garnered a reputation for its reliability and practicality. One of the critical components ensuring the smooth operation of this vehicle is its water pump. The water pump plays an indispensable role in maintaining the engine's temperature to prevent overheating, ensuring that your Holden Captiva runs just right.
Water pumps in vehicles like the 2009 Holden Captiva 7 are crafted to regulate the coolant flow from the radiator to the engine. When a water pump starts to fail, it can lead to a chain reaction of engine problems. Fortunately, drivers can keep their eyes peeled for certain signs that the pump might be on the decline and often avoid complete failure. It's all about understanding when it's time to swap out your existing pump for a shiny new one.
If you notice symptoms such as coolant leaks, unusual noises coming from the front of the engine, or even overheating issues, it might be time to have your water pump checked. Coolant leaks often appear as a small puddle under the vehicle, usually tinted with the color of the coolant in use. Strange noises, such as whining or grinding sounds, may indicate that the pump's bearings or another internal component are worn down.
Replacing a faulty water pump is essential in sustaining the life of your vehicle's engine. The repair process generally involves a thorough overhaul of several components around the water pump itself. For those considering a do-it-yourself approach, indispensable tools and a bit of mechanical knowledge will surely come into play.
- Inspect the cooling system for other potential problems.
- Drain the engine coolant safely.
- Disassemble the required components for access.
- Remove the old water pump and install the new one.
- Reassemble and refill the cooling system with fresh coolant.
